Traffic Signs APK is an Android application concept designed to help learners understand road signs, traffic rules, road markings, and driving test requirements. These apps can be particularly useful for people preparing for a driving license test in Pakistan.

Learning traffic signs is an important part of becoming a responsible driver. Pakistani road safety materials classify traffic signs into categories such as mandatory and warning signs. Mandatory signs communicate rules or restrictions that road users must follow, while warning signs alert drivers to potentially hazardous road conditions. (National Health and Population Ministry)

Warning Traffic Signs

Warning signs alert drivers about possible hazards.

They help road users prepare for changing road conditions.

Examples can include signs warning about:

Sharp turns.

Road crossings.

Pedestrians.

Animals.

Uneven roads.

Narrow roads.

Slippery surfaces.

Road construction.

Warning signs are generally displayed in a triangular format in Pakistani road safety material. (National Health and Population Ministry)

Mandatory Traffic Signs

Mandatory signs communicate requirements that road users must follow.

They can indicate:

Required directions.

Restrictions.

Prohibited movements.

Special obligations.

Other regulatory requirements.

Many mandatory signs use a circular format. Pakistani road safety guidance explains that these signs communicate laws, restrictions, or obligations for road users. (National Health and Population Ministry)

Traffic Signals

Traffic signals control the movement of vehicles and pedestrians.

The most familiar signals are:

Red.

Yellow.

Green.

Red generally means stop.

Yellow indicates caution and preparation for a change.

Green generally permits movement when the road is clear and other rules allow it.

Drivers should always follow the actual signal and road conditions rather than relying only on memorized information.

Limitations Of Traffic Signs APK

A mobile application should not replace practical driving training.

Some apps may contain advertisements.

Information may become outdated.

Different applications may contain different sign collections.

Test formats can change.

The application may not represent the exact examination used in every licensing center.

Always treat an app as a learning aid and verify current licensing requirements with the relevant authority.
